Commercial Slab Installation in Fort Lauderdale, FL
Commercial slab installation services involve preparing and pouring concrete slabs that serve as the foundation for various types of structures, such as retail stores, warehouses, parking lots, and industrial facilities. These projects typically require precise planning to ensure proper support, durability, and levelness, especially in areas with heavy foot or vehicle traffic. Property owners interested in this service should understand the importance of site preparation, including soil assessment and grading, as well as the need for appropriate reinforcement to withstand daily use and environmental conditions.
Before requesting commercial slab installation, property owners often want to know about the scope of work, including the size and thickness of the slab, as well as the materials used. Clarifying project timelines, any necessary permits, and potential impact on property access can help ensure a smooth process. Proper communication about these details can contribute to a successful installation that meets the specific needs of the property and its intended use.

Commercial Slab Installation Questions
What types of projects require commercial slab installation? Commercial slab installation is commonly used for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and outdoor workspaces on commercial properties in Fort Lauderdale.
What materials are typically used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the most common material for commercial slabs, chosen for its durability and ability to support heavy loads.
How thick should a commercial slab be? The thickness of a commercial slab depends on its intended use, but generally ranges from 4 to 8 inches to support heavy equipment and traffic.
What should property owners consider before installation? Proper site preparation, soil stability, and load requirements are important factors to ensure a long-lasting and functional slab.
